Unlocking the Power of Real-Time Data Processing with Python: A Guide for Aspiring Professionals

December 28, 2025 4 min read Matthew Singh

Unlock real-time data processing skills with Python and advance your career in data science.

Are you passionate about data and eager to leverage Python for real-time data processing? The Postgraduate Certificate in Real-Time Data Processing with Python is an excellent stepping stone for those looking to enhance their skills and open up new career opportunities. This comprehensive guide will help you understand the essential skills, best practices, and career prospects associated with this exciting field.

Understanding the Basics: Key Skills for Real-Time Data Processing

Before diving into the nitty-gritty, it's crucial to understand the foundational skills required for real-time data processing with Python. This certificate program focuses heavily on equipping you with the necessary tools and techniques.

# 1. Python Programming Fundamentals

Python is the go-to language for many data processing tasks due to its simplicity and powerful libraries. You'll start by mastering the basics of Python, including data structures, control flow, and functions. This foundational knowledge is essential for efficiently processing and analyzing real-time data streams.

# 2. Understanding Real-Time Data Streams

Real-time data processing involves working with data as it is generated, rather than in batches. You'll learn how to handle and process data streams using Python, understanding concepts like event-driven programming and asynchronous processing. This skill is vital for applications such as financial trading systems, IoT device monitoring, and live analytics.

# 3. Data Processing Libraries and Tools

One of the strengths of Python is its extensive library ecosystem. The program will introduce you to libraries like Apache Kafka for stream processing, Pandas for data manipulation, and NumPy for numerical operations. Mastering these tools will enable you to handle complex data processing tasks efficiently.

Best Practices for Real-Time Data Processing

In addition to technical skills, understanding best practices is crucial for success in real-time data processing. Here are some key practices you'll learn:

# 1. Data Privacy and Security

Data processing often involves handling sensitive information. You'll learn how to implement secure data processing practices, including encryption, secure data transmission, and compliance with data protection regulations like GDPR.

# 2. Scalability and Performance Optimization

Real-time data processing requires systems that can handle high volumes of data efficiently. You'll explore techniques for optimizing performance, such as parallel processing, caching, and load balancing. Understanding how to scale your applications will be crucial for handling large-scale data processing tasks.

# 3. Debugging and Monitoring

Real-time data streams can be unpredictable, and bugs can be difficult to trace. You'll learn how to effectively debug and monitor your applications using tools like logging, profiling, and continuous integration. This will help you maintain the reliability and stability of your data processing pipelines.

Career Opportunities in Real-Time Data Processing

The demand for professionals skilled in real-time data processing is on the rise. Here are some career paths you might consider:

# 1. Data Engineer

Data engineers are responsible for designing, building, and maintaining the infrastructure necessary to support real-time data processing. This includes setting up stream processing systems, integrating data from various sources, and ensuring data quality.

# 2. Real-Time Analytics Specialist

Specialists in real-time analytics use their skills to provide actionable insights from live data. This could involve building dashboards, creating predictive models, and developing algorithms for real-time decision-making.

# 3. IoT Systems Integrator

With the rise of IoT devices, there's a growing need for professionals who can integrate these devices into real-time data processing pipelines. This involves understanding both the hardware and software aspects of IoT systems and ensuring seamless data collection and analysis.

Conclusion

The Postgraduate Certificate in Real-Time Data Processing with Python is a valuable investment for anyone looking to advance their career in data science and engineering. By mastering the essential skills, following best practices, and exploring career opportunities, you can position yourself at the forefront of this exciting field. Whether you're a seasoned

Ready to Transform Your Career?

Take the next step in your professional journey with our comprehensive course designed for business leaders

Disclaimer

The views and opinions expressed in this blog are those of the individual authors and do not necessarily reflect the official policy or position of LSBR London - Executive Education. The content is created for educational purposes by professionals and students as part of their continuous learning journey. LSBR London - Executive Education does not guarantee the accuracy, completeness, or reliability of the information presented. Any action you take based on the information in this blog is strictly at your own risk. LSBR London - Executive Education and its affiliates will not be liable for any losses or damages in connection with the use of this blog content.

2,998 views
Back to Blog

This course help you to:

  • Boost your Salary
  • Increase your Professional Reputation, and
  • Expand your Networking Opportunities

Ready to take the next step?

Enrol now in the

Postgraduate Certificate in Real-Time Data Processing with Python

Enrol Now